Frontier-area historical tornado activity is above North Dakota state average. It is 7% smaller than the overall U.S. average. On 6/28/1975, a category 4 (max. wind speeds 207-260 mph) tornado 8.6 miles away from the Frontier city center caused between $50,000 and $500,000 in damages. On 6/20/1957, a category 5 (max. wind speeds 261-318 mph) tornado 36.2 miles away from the city center killed 10 people and injured 103 people and caused between $5,000,000 and $50,000,000 in damages.
